    Op zaterdag 10 januari 2004 19:50, schreef Ivanovich:
    > In the same instant i click to change an option in the "Expert" menu,
    > Synaptic crashes:
    >
    > synaptic: relocation error: synaptic: undefined symbol:
    > _ZN15pkgVersionMatchC1ESsNS_9MatchTypeEi
    >
    > The same happens when double-clicking python for upgrade, from
    > python-2.3-49 to 2.3.1-0 (which happens to have unmet dependencies
    > libcrypto.so.0.9.6 and libssl.so.0.9.6, (that is openssl from 8.2, broken
    > package?), it's in the suser-kpietrz repository)
    >
    > This is with synaptic-0.47-rb2
    >
    > Note: I updated my system from 8.2 to 9.0 via apt some days ago, all seems
    > to be working well except for that python package

    If you downgrade synaptic this problem may go away. It is probably caused by
    an binary incompatability between the apt-libs and synaptic. Synaptic has
    been compiled with a different apt version than you are using.
